Join us on Saturday, August 16 at Huset Park in Columbia Heights for a fun-filled celebration of Polish culture and community! The Polish Picnic is organized by PACIM, Sister Cities International Columbia Heights, and the Polish Saturday School.

This year’s event features a fresh format with:

  • Live music and traditional dance performances featuring Craig Ebel & DyVersaCo polka band, Joe Mack (accordion), and the Dolina Polish Folk Dancers
  • Delicious Polish cuisine available for purchase
  • Entertainment for all ages, including:
    • Games, arts and crafts
    • Splash pad
    • Playground
  • Participation from many local organizations and community groups
    …and much more!

The event is free to all!
